1.JAVA基本数据类型
2.整数和小数取值范围
double>float>long>int>short>byte
对于float型变量 需在数据末尾加F/f作为后缀以区分double变量;
对于long型变量 须在数据末尾加上L区分int变量;
3.实际操作
计算BMI指数
public class NEWtest {
public static void main(String[] args) {
double height= 1.74;
int weight =75;
double exponent =weight / (height * height);
System.out.println("您的身高为:"+height);
System.out.println("您的体重为:"+weight);
System.out.println("您的BMI指数为:"+exponent);
System.out.println("您的1体重属于:");
if(exponent <18.5){
System.out.println("体重过轻");
}
if(exponent >= 18.5 && exponent <24.9){
System.out.println("正常范围");
}
if(exponent >=29.9) {
System.out.println("体重过重");
}
if(exponent >=24.9&& exponent <29.9){
System.out.println("肥胖");
}
}
}
输出结果
4. 字符类型
原始数据类型 | 参考数据类型 |
数量有限 | 数量无限 |
存储数据 | 存储地址 |
仅能容纳一个值 | 可以容纳多个值 |
转义序列:
一般地,C/C++ 等中用一个 " \ "引入一个转义序列;任何东西前面带有 " \ "即为转义序列的开始;
转移序列由 " \ "加上几个紧跟的字符构成;
\ | 单引号字符 | \n | 换行 |
\\ | 反斜杠字符 | \b | 退格 |
\t | 垂直制表符 | \f | 换页 |
课堂实例:
垂直制表符的使用效果,如图所示